Israel’s military operation in Nuseirat refugee camp would not affect the current prisoner-hostage swap deal, said Mohammad Al Hindi, deputy chief of Palestinian Islamic Jihad. He said, in comments to Hamas-affiliated Al Aqsa TV, that conditions for the deal remained the same.
